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Paperform
- Free plan limited to 30 submissions per month
- Additional submissions beyond plan limits incur overage fees
- Custom domains require additional $20 per month fee on Pro plan
Qualtrics CoreXM
- There is no public pricing for any deployment beyond a small individual self-service plan, so budgeting requires a sales conversation before a shortlist can even be built.
- Typical small enterprise contracts run 25,000 to 50,000 US dollars a year, which puts it far outside the budget of small businesses that Typeform, Jotform or SurveyMonkey serve well.
- The interface and logic builder have a steep learning curve compared with lighter tools, so new users need training before building complex surveys confidently.
- It is easy to confuse with Qualtrics EmployeeXM in the same product family; buyers evaluating employee engagement specifically should look at EmployeeXM, not CoreXM.
- Multi-year contracts with per-module add-ons mean the effective cost tends to grow year over year as teams add capabilities piecemeal.
Pricing, plan by plan
Paperform
Free- FreeFree
- 1 user
- 30 submissions per month
- 5 payment submissions per month
- Essentials$24/month
- 1 user
- 1,200 submissions per year
- 240 payment submissions per year
- Pro$49/month
- 3 users
- 12,000 submissions per year
- 3,000 payment submissions per year
- Business$99/month
- 5 users plus $9 per additional user (up to 25)
- 120,000 submissions per year
- 30,000 payment submissions per year
Qualtrics CoreXM
On request- CoreXM$undefined/year
- Self-service entry plan around 35 USD a month for small individual use
- Typical small enterprise contracts between 25,000 and 50,000 USD a year
- Priced by seats, response volume and modules selected

Answered from the vendors’ own pages
Paperform: Is there a free version of Paperform?
Yes, Paperform offers a free plan with 1 user, 30 submissions per month, and 100 MB storage at no cost.
SourceQualtrics CoreXM: How is CoreXM different from Qualtrics EmployeeXM?
CoreXM is the general-purpose survey and market research engine; EmployeeXM is a separate, HR-focused product built specifically for employee engagement programmes.
Paperform: Does Paperform offer a free trial for paid plans?
Paperform offers a 7-day unrestricted trial for all paid plans without requiring a credit card.
SourceQualtrics CoreXM: Is there a published price list?
No, only a small self-service plan around 35 USD a month is public; organisational deployments are negotiated and typically run into five or six figures annually.
Paperform: What payment processing options does Paperform support?
All Paperform plans include payment processing via Stripe, Square, Braintree, or PayPal.
SourceQualtrics CoreXM: Does CoreXM include text analytics?
Yes, automated theme and sentiment extraction on open-ended responses is included as a core capability.
Paperform: When does Paperform charge for custom domains?
Custom domains are available on the Pro and Business plans, with an additional $20 per month fee for this feature.
